WebSoap Dispenser for Kitchen Sink, Built in Sink Soap Dispenser (Brushed Nickel), Countertop Soap Dispenser Pump with 47" Extension Tube kit, No Need to Fill Little Bottle Again (Longer Thread Shaft) 4.4 (2,725) 100+ bought in past week $1986 FREE delivery Wed, Apr 5 on $25 of items shipped by Amazon Or fastest delivery Mon, Apr 3 WebStep 2 Fill the sink with hot water, and place the pump parts in the sink. Soak the pump for several minutes. Step 3 Use the scrub brush or toothbrush to scrub the pump, especially at connection points and the opening of the pump head. This will remove any dry soap residue.
